    One of the sad things about the new album, regardless of how great it is (and I do think it will be great if it’s ever released by the way), is that it will never be as big as it could have been, say if it were released during the short-lived ’96 reunion for example. I guess that doesn’t really matter for us hardcore fans of the band, but the mainstream media will not play as much attention to it now as they would have in the past. The reasons are pretty obvious for the most part. The music industry in terms of album sales is largely a thing of the past. Everyone pretty much downloads these days, so album sales will be muted no matter what the album sounds like. More mainstream music is also almost always centered on younger acts too, so the press hype won’t be out in full force anymore like it would have been. Finally, I think the band’s overall popularity will be hurt by the seemingly eternal lack of contact with their fan base. A great deal of momentum has been lost, and regardless of how sharp the music turns out, you can bet many critics will point to the age of the band, and say they are past their prime and that it doesn’t measure up to the classics. That’s a shame. No, Van Halen doesn’t owe us anything as some like to point out, but it’s simply not good PR to leave your fans hanging forever and a day. Why would you want to torture the people who collectively are still responsible for your livelihood when all is said and done? You would think they’d have genuine affection for their fans and not want to treat them like the enemy, as it sometimes seems quite frankly.

    In any event, like most of us, I’m still excited as heck about the new album and tour. It still could be plenty big, just not as big as what might have been years ago. I just wish this endless game would finally be over already. Come on guys, give us a break.
